Company Summary

Vaxdyn is a biotechnology enterprise located in Seville, Spain, specializing in the early-stage development of vaccines for multi-drug resistant bacterial infections using innovative antigen-design approaches. Our business model´s objective is to advance our candidates to phase II clinical trials in order to be acquired by a major pharmaceutical company.
